Key Players
For DRX
- free1ng: DRX’s star player doesn’t just aim—he executes. With one of the highest clutch rates in the Pacific League and a KDA that only gets more impressive under pressure, Free1ng is the backbone of DRX’s firepower. He managed to get 47 kills for his team!
- BeYN: The definition of consistency. While BeYN may not capture the spotlight often, his calm and collected demeanor underpins DRX’s rock-solid defense and sharp utility usage. BeYN was able to get 40 kills from the opposite team and win his team the match.
For Gen.G
- t3xture: A name every VALORANT fan knows by now. t3xture’s hyper-aggressive entries and jaw-dropping flick shots scored him 36 kills with an ACS (average combat score) of 205.
- Foxy9: Gen.. G’s secret weapon. His ability to adapt mid-match and make game-changing plays has turned close losses into thrilling comebacks multiple times this season.
Series Breakdown: Gen.G vs DRX
These two teams have faced each other eight times in the past year. DRX leads the record with four wins to Gen.G’s three. DRX gained its 5th victory in this DRX vs GEN G Valorant competition.

FAQ
How do DRX and Gen.G typically counter each other tactically?
DRX focuses on slowing down Gen.G’s aggression by using perfect utility placement and holding key sightlines. On the other hand, Gen.G often throws DRX off balance by executing rapid attacks and forcing early fights.
Has Gen.G ever won a series against DRX?
Yes, Gen.G managed to secure a thrilling victory against DRX in late 2024 during a smaller tournament. However, they’ve yet to conquer DRX in the VCT Pacific league, which adds to the stakes of this matchup.
Which maps are historically best for DRX and Gen.G?
DRX has one of the highest win rates on tactical maps like Haven, while Gen.G boasts dominance on Split and Bind, thanks to their fast-paced execution strategies.
